
White Salt Powder
Sodium chloride
Pronunciation: SOH-dee-um KLOR-ide
Clean salinity
A refined salt used to season and balance flavour across the product.
Did you know?
Salt does not just make food taste salty — it also amplifies sweetness, acidity, and savouriness.
